Pre-test considerations
No fasting required. For menstruating women, cycle day matters: LH varies sharply across the cycle and surges at ovulation, so note the day of your cycle and follow your clinician's timing guidance. Biotin supplements and recent fertility medications or hormonal contraception can affect results, so mention what you take.

What this test is for
Luteinizing hormone (LH) is released by the pituitary gland and regulates the reproductive axis: in women it triggers ovulation, and in men it signals the testes to produce testosterone. Measuring LH helps locate where a hormonal problem sits, because the pattern distinguishes primary gonadal failure (LH runs high as the pituitary pushes harder) from a pituitary or hypothalamic cause (LH is low or inappropriately normal). It is commonly checked when investigating irregular or absent periods, infertility, suspected PCOS, low testosterone, low libido, early or delayed puberty, and the transition to menopause. LH is most informative read alongside FSH, estradiol or testosterone, and prolactin, since the combination clarifies the picture.
